Red Hat: EAL 4+ Certification For Cloud Secure Deployment

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6, including the KVM hypervisor, has been awarded a major security certification used by IT in government, financial and other mission-critical verticals. By receiving the Common Criteria Certification at Evaluation Assurance Level (EAL) 4+, which is the highest level of assurance for an unmodified commercial operating system, Red Hat can assure public sector customers looking at cloud and virtualization will meet a range of important security assurance requirements.. Notably,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6 features Security-Enhanced Linux (SELinux), a joint project developed with the National Security Agency (NSA). The certification provides assurance that using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6 with the KVM hypervisor allows providers to host many tenants on the same machine while keeping their virtual guests separated from each other using Mandatory Access Control technology developed by the NSA, according to Paul Smith, Red Hat. Microsoft Argues Google Misleads on Security of Government Apps

Microsoft today continued its cat fight with Google, calling out the company for apparently misleading customers about the security of its applications. The software giant alleges that Google Apps for Government doesn't meet the level of security that Google claims. . In a blog post, Microsoft's corporate vice president and deputy general counsel, David Howard, said that Google's Web-based productivity suite for government clients is not certified under the Federal Information Security Management Act. U.S. Government Security Compliance: Encryption and 2FA for Agencies

The Bush Administration is giving federal civilian agencies just 45 days to comply with new recommendations for laptop encryption and two-factor authentication. The memo follows a wave of high profile data thefts and major security breeches involving remote access or the theft of government laptop computers containing sensitive personal information. The official memo (PDF) from the executive office of the U.S. president stipulates that all mobile devices containing sensitive information must have their data encrypted. . The recommendations also say that two-factor authentication must be used for remote access, that remote access must time out after 30 minutes of inactivity, and that all data extracts must be logged. The memo does not detail any specific technology recommendations beyond this broad outline, presumably leaving agencies to decide on their own specific implementations. "Most departments and agencies have these measures already in place," wrote Clay Johnson III, the Deputy Director for Management who authored the memo. That's an assertion that is hard to believe in the wake of some high profile data thefts in the past year involving government systems that were not using any encryption or two-factor authentication. SuSE Linux Enterprise Server 9 EAL 4+ Certification Approved for Use

IBM and Novell announced at LinuxWorld today that SuSE Linux Enterprise Server 9 has become the first distribution to complete Evaluation Assurance Level (EAL) 4+. The high security rating will enable the operating system to be adopted by governments and government agencies for mission-critical operations, according to the firms. . In addition, IBM and Novell co-operatively achieved US Department of Defense Common Operating Environment compliance, a Defense Information Systems Agency requirement for military computing products. SuSE Linux Enterprise Server 9 on IBM eServers has achieved Controlled Access Protection Profile under the Common Criteria for Information Security Evaluation, also referred to as CAPP/EAL4+. HP: Certified Linux EAL 3 For Government Security Compliance

Hewlett Packard Co has completed the certification of Linux on its servers and workstations with evaluation assurance level 3 of the Common Criteria security evaluation and is now looking to the next level. . . .. 11 Oct 2004, 09:35 GMT - The certification is an important security consideration for North American and European government agencies and departments and puts Palo Alto, California-based HP's hardware running Linux on the same level as rival IBM Corp. HP has certified both Red Hat Inc Enterprise Linux and Novell Inc's SuSE Linux running on its ProLiant and Itanium systems at evaluation assurance level (EAL) 3 with Controlled Access Protection Profile (CAPP). DOT Dismisses Privacy Claim Against Northwest Airlines Case

The U.S. Department of Transportation has dismissed a claim filed against Northwest Airlines that accused the carrier of violating its own privacy policy when it gave government officials passenger . . .. The U.S. Department of Transportation has dismissed a claim filed against Northwest Airlines that accused the carrier of violating its own privacy policy when it gave government officials passenger information related to the Sept. 11 attacks. The department ruled late last week that Northwest's privacy policy, which was published on the airline's Web site, does not preclude the company from sharing data with the federal government, specifically when asked to do so. In fact, the department found that Northwest, which is based in Eagan, Minn., is required by law to make records, including passenger data, available to federal agencies "upon demand," according to a statement. The complaint, filed by consumer privacy watchdog Electronic Privacy Information Center (EPIC), which is based in Washington, D.C., and the Minnesota Civil Liberties Union, contended that Northwest engaged in unfair and deceptive practices when it shared passenger name and record data with the National Aeronautics and Space Administration. The Ames Research Center at NASA had sought the information in the months following Sept. 11 to aid in its efforts to make air travel safer, according to the Transportation Department. . SuSE Linux Enterprise Server Secures EAL2 Certification for Military Use

SuSE and IBM have achieved a crucial security certification that will let the US government and military choose the operating system.. . .. SuSE and IBM have achieved a crucial security certification that will let the US government and military choose the operating system. Linux seller SuSE and server maker IBM have obtained a crucial security certification that will make the operating system an option for demanding military and government customers, the companies are expected to announce on Tuesday. Many governments require certification to the international Common Criteria standard before they're allowed to purchase a specific computing product. SuSE Linux Enterprise Server 8 running on IBM's Intel-based xSeries servers achieved Evaluation Assurance Level 2 (EAL2) of the Common Criteria, the companies are expected to announce at the LinuxWorld Conference and Expo.
